Advanced colon cancer patients lived twice as long with a Pfizer combo therapy, trial finds

A combination drug treatment doubled survival time for patients with an aggressive form of colorectal cancer.

The three -treatment combination included a standard chemotherapy drug, an antibody drug called cetuximab and a pill from Pfizer called Braftovi .

The Food and Drug Administration granted the treatment fast-track approval as a first -line approach in December .
